Demand environment and stability, pricing dynamics and margins, CDMO revenue and margins, pricing strategy and margins, visibility and cancelations in DSA are the key contradictions discussed in Charles River Laboratories' latest 2025Q2 earnings call.
Revenue and Financial Performance:
- Charles River LaboratoriesCRL-- reported revenue of $1.03 billion in Q2 2025, a 0.6% increase over the previous year, with organic revenue declining by 0.5%.
- The growth was primarily driven by favorable DSA results, benefiting from strong booking activity in the previous quarter and favorable foreign exchange rates.
Demand and Order Trends:
- The DSA segment experienced a 6% and 13% increase in first-half gross and net bookings, respectively, year-over-year.
- Demand trends reflect a stabilizing environment, with gross and net bookings both improving at mid-single-digit rates, supported by constructive discussions with clients and strong bookings in the first quarter.
Strategic Initiatives:
- The company reported a 27.4% operating margin in DSA, attributed to operating leverage and favorable mix of higher-priced, longer-duration studies.
- Charles River emphasized its focus on NAMs-enabled approaches, with a significant portion of the DSA revenue coming from NAMs solutions, indicating a strategic shift towards more non-animal model methods.
Regulatory and Market Developments:
- The U.S. government cleared all NHP shipments from Cambodia, validating the company's conduct and providing operational flexibility.
- Charles River's strategic review is ongoing, focusing on value creation through portfolio evaluations and capital allocation.
